Compare all specifications:
1970 Abarth 1300 | 2005 Chevrolet Blazer | |
Make | Abarth | Chevrolet |
Model | 1300 | Blazer |
Year Released | 1970 | 2005 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 1279 cc | 4294 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 123 HP | 190 HP |
Engine RPM | 7200 RPM | 5600 RPM |
Torque | 130 Nm | 339 Nm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 10.6:1 | 9.2:1 |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 630 kg | 1762 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3560 mm | 4510 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1490 mm | 1730 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1140 mm | 1650 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2100 mm | 2560 mm |
